Overview of the Business Visa

The Business Visa, also known as the UK Business Visitor Visa or Standard Visitor Visa (Business), is designed for individuals who wish to visit the UK for short-term business-related activities. This visa category allows holders to engage in a range of permissible activities, including attending meetings, conferences, and seminars, negotiating contracts, and conducting market research. It also caters to entrepreneurs exploring business opportunities, investors seeking to invest in UK-based ventures, and professionals participating in training programs or conducting academic research.

Eligibility Criteria

To qualify for a Business Visa in the UK, applicants must meet certain eligibility criteria set forth by the UK Visas and Immigration (UKVI). While the specific requirements may vary depending on individual circumstances and the nature of the proposed business activities, the following are common eligibility criteria:

1. Purpose of Visit: Applicants must demonstrate a genuine intention to visit the UK for business-related purposes only. This may include attending meetings, conferences, trade fairs, or other professional events relevant to their field of expertise.

2. Financial Stability: Applicants must possess sufficient funds to cover their travel and living expenses during their stay in the UK. They may need to provide evidence of financial stability, such as bank statements or sponsorship letters, to support their application.

3. Ties to Home Country: Applicants must prove strong ties to their home country, such as employment, property ownership, or family commitments, to ensure their intention to return after the visit.

4. Immigration History: Applicants must have a clean immigration history and abide by the UK’s immigration laws. Any previous visa refusals or immigration violations may affect the outcome of the application.

5. Health and Character Requirements: Applicants must meet the UK’s health and character requirements, which may include undergoing medical examinations or providing police clearance certificates, depending on the duration and purpose of the visit.

Application Process

The application process for a Business Visa in the UK typically involves several steps, including completing an online application form, providing supporting documents, attending a biometric appointment, and paying the relevant visa fees. Here is an overview of the application process:

1. Online Application: Applicants must complete the online visa application form available on the official website of the UK Visas and Immigration. They will be required to provide personal details, travel history, and information about the purpose of their visit.

2. Supporting Documents: Applicants must gather and submit the required supporting documents to substantiate their visa application. These may include a valid passport, recent photographs, travel itinerary, invitation letters from UK-based companies or organizations, proof of financial means, and any other documents relevant to the purpose of the visit.

3. Biometric Appointment: Once the online application is submitted, applicants will need to schedule a biometric appointment at a designated visa application center. During the appointment, applicants will have their fingerprints and photograph taken as part of the biometric data collection process.

4. Visa Interview (if required): In some cases, applicants may be required to attend a visa interview at the UK embassy or consulate in their home country. The purpose of the interview is to assess the applicant’s intentions, eligibility, and credibility.

5. Visa Decision: After the completion of the biometric appointment and submission of all required documents, applicants must wait for a decision on their visa application. The processing time may vary depending on the applicant’s nationality, the complexity of the case, and the volume of applications received.

6. Visa Collection: Once the visa application is processed and approved, applicants will be notified to collect their visa either from the visa application center or via mail, depending on the chosen option during the application process.

Benefits of the Business Visa

The Business Visa offers several benefits to individuals seeking to engage in business activities in the UK:

1. Flexibility: The Business Visa allows holders to enter the UK multiple times within the validity period, enabling them to conduct multiple business trips without the need for a new visa each time.

2. Short-Term Stay: The visa permits stays of up to six months per visit, providing ample time for business meetings, negotiations, and other professional engagements.

3. Networking Opportunities: Business visitors can leverage their time in the UK to network with potential clients, partners, suppliers, and industry professionals, fostering valuable business relationships and collaborations.

4. Exploration of Business Opportunities: Entrepreneurs and investors can use their visit to explore potential business opportunities in the UK, assess market conditions, and meet with local stakeholders.

5. Professional Development: Professionals attending conferences, seminars, or training programs can enhance their skills, knowledge, and professional network through participation in UK-based events and activities.

6. Cultural Experience: In addition to business activities, visitors can also experience the rich cultural heritage, landmarks, and attractions that the UK has to offer, enriching their overall travel experience.
